Abstract

The present invention relates to an arrangement having at least one solar cell, which is formed by a first sequence of differently doped layers () on a substrate (), and at least one bypass diode, which is connected to the solar cell, particularly in a monolithic, series-connected solar module. The arrangement is characterized in that the bypass diode is formed by a second sequence of layers (), which is arranged between the substrate () and the first layer sequence (). With the proposed arrangement monolithic, series-connected solar modules can be formed at a very low loss of active receiving surface, the solar cells of which are protected by bypass diodes.
